Dear Bryant,
Even though I think you can be an insufferable *&^$# sometimes, you have the best sports show on TV right now. “Real Sports” is to sports reporting as “60 Minutes” is to news reporting. Watched your latest edition last night. Mary Carillo did a great story on former professional boxer trying to overcome his Parkinson’s disease while training other fighters. But please tell Frank Deford to stop trying to make me cry. His story on a little girl with a brain tumor adopted by the women’s Lacrosse team at Northwestern who then went on to win five straight championships, brought a lump to my throat. It’s just not manly to be watching a sports show and tear up.
Thanks, Scott
P.S. Sorry about the “insufferable *&^$#” thing.
